International star Ewan McGregor will play the famous gambler Sky Masterson in the Donmar Warehouse's new production of Guys and Dolls, to be directed by the Donmar's award - winning Artistic Director Michael Grandage.

Guys and Dolls tells the story of a group of small - time gamblers and the ladies in their lives. Nathan Detroit bets his pal Sky Masterson that he can't make the next lady he sees fall in love with him, and when the next lady happens to be the prim and proper neighbourhood missionary Sarah Brown, the stage is set for an evening of high spirited entertainment, set to the toe tapping beat of Loesser's superlative compositions.

Ewan McGregor makes a welcome return to the West End since Little Malcolm and His Struggle Against the Eunachs in 1999.He is best known internationally for big screen credits such as Star Wars,Down With Love,Little Voice, A Life Less Ordinary,Trainspotting and Brassed Off. He also won huge critical acclaim alongside Nicole Kidman in Baz Luhrmann's musical movie Moulin Rouge.Michael Grandage's award - winning musical theatre credits include Merrily We Roll Along,Privates on Parade and the current critically acclaimed hit Grand Hotel.

Frank Loesser's score features classic songs such as 'Luck be a Lady', 'Sit Down Your Rocking the Boat', 'Adelaide's Lament', 'I've Never Been in Love Before', 'If I Were a Bell' and the wonderful title song 'Guys and Dolls'.
